]> git.sesse.net Git - remoteglot-book/blobdiff - build-book.sh
Store and merge the file number information. Still unused in the UI.
[remoteglot-book] / build-book.sh
index 7d49663f5fb6f2c90a2bcff821287c6d130b0db2..e6e8c09afa4def12b1b1a07cb01868b634d215c7 100755 (executable)
@@ -5,12 +5,15 @@ set -e
 export SHARDS=40
 export PARALLEL_LOADS=20  # Reduce if you have problems with OOM
 
-rm -f part-*.bin part-*.mtbl part-*.mtbl.part???? open.mtbl.new open.mtbl.part???? open.mtbl.part????.new 2>/dev/null
+rm -f pgnnames.txt part-*.bin part-*.mtbl part-*.mtbl.part???? open.mtbl.new open.mtbl.part???? open.mtbl.part????.new 2>/dev/null
 
+PGNNUM=0
 for FILE in "$@"; do
        date | tr -d "\n"
        echo "  $FILE"
-       ./parallel-parse-pgn.sh "$FILE"
+       ./parallel-parse-pgn.sh "$FILE" "$PGNNUM"
+       echo "$FILE" >> pgnnames.txt
+       PGNNUM=$(( PGNNUM + 1 ))
 done
 date